Output 170784b4fe392e6b9524a52dd46d4803931816daef7ee91dc265bcf92426635b:0

value
21526799
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f39c5e81d38ba230a1587d32e2e2392a6bb0e87d OP_EQUALVERIFY OP_CHECKSIG
address
1PD6XLSF7tYurHjPXwLHD82LmZUyDuM3Mj
transaction
170784b4fe392e6b9524a52dd46d4803931816daef7ee91dc265bcf92426635b
spent
true